The growth in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ED)[TM] New Construction (NC) registered projects and U.S. Green Building Council (USGBC) membership is inexorably linked. The buzz around rapid LEED market penetration attracts new members, and new members initiate new projects, fueling the buzz.
This feed-forward is accelerating LEED diffusion to ever finer market sectors such as retail, speculative development and campuses. LEED for Existing Buildings (EB) and Commercial Interiors (CI) are poised for prime time.
